Tafsir Ibn Abbas: An-Naml, Ayah 62

An-Naml · Ayah 62 · View Ayah
أَمَّن يُجِيبُ ٱلْمُضْطَرَّ إِذَا دَعَاهُ وَيَكْشِفُ ٱلسُّوٓءَ وَيَجْعَلُكُمْ خُلَفَآءَ ٱلْأَرْضِ ۗ أَءِلَٰهٌۭ مَّعَ ٱللَّهِ ۚ قَلِيلًۭا مَّا تَذَكَّرُونَ
Is He [not best] who responds to the desperate one when he calls upon Him and removes evil and makes you inheritors of the earth? Is there a deity with Allah? Little do you remember.

Ibn Abbas Commentary

(Is not He (best) who answereth the wronged one) in his distress (when he crieth unto Him) to drive away his misfortune (and removeth the evil) by removing misfortunes, (and hath made you vicegerents of the earth) the dwellers of the earth after the destruction of its people? (Is there any God beside Allah) who did this? (Little do they reflect!) they derive no admonition at all from this.

Or He Who answers the desperate one the anguished person suffering harm when he calls to Him and Who removes his distress from him and from others and makes you successors in the earth the annexation khulafā’a l-ardi ‘successors of the earth’ has the same meaning as fī ‘in’ khulafā’a fī’l-ardi ‘successors in the earth’ in other words each generation succeeding the one before it. Is there a god with God? Little do you remember little are you admonished read mā tadhakkarūna ‘do you remember’; or read yadhdhakkarūna ‘do they remember’ where in both cases the tā’ has been assimilated with the dhāl; the mā is extra used to make less what is already ‘little’.
